Synopsis

THE STORY: Amy's found another body in a hotel bedroom.

There's a funny smell coming from one of Jim's storage units.

And Kate's losing it after spending all day with the police.

There's no going back after what they've seen.

Breathing Corpses is a American mystery play written by Laura Wade and published by Dramatists Play Service in New York (2006).
